Mens Bball on National TV
Toledo’s January home games against Ball St., Western Mich., and Eastern Mich., and road tilt at Buffalo will all be carried nationally on CBS Sports Network. The Rockets might also be chosen for February and March MAC Wild Card games that will be announced at a later date.
